SMD Schottky Barrier Rectifiers
CDBB120-G Thru. CDBB1100-G
Reverse Voltage: 20 to 100 Volts
Forward Current: 1.0 Amp
RoHS Device
Features
-Ideal for surface mount applications.
-Easy pick and place.
-Plastic package has Underwriters Lab.
flammability classification 94V-0.
-Built-in strain relief.
-Low forward voltage drop.

Mechanical data
-Case: JEDEC DO-214AA, molded plastic.
-Terminals: solderable per MIL-STD-750,
method 2026.
-Polarity: Color band denotes cathode end.
-Approx. weight: 0.093 grams
